Gardening is more popular than ever, experiencing a renaissance over the pandemic and becoming more interesting for investment and broader export opportunities. Three trends drive gardening spend priorities. Lawn space has been giving way to growing space. Compost sales indicate regional priority gaps between the rise of growing-your-own food versus decorative plants. Peat-free claims and innovation grow, because global compost leaders face strict UK regulation in their home market.
